Nepal defence cadres hurled bomb during mass meeting
Kathmandu, Jan 19 (UNI) The cadres of the Nepal Defence Army (NDA), supporting the monarchy, hurled a bomb at a micro-bus at Bhotahity on January 14 during the mass meeting of the seven-party alliance in Kathmandu, Nepal police today said.
''They had actually tried to trigger the blast at the dias where the seven-party leaders were sitting during the mass meeting but did not dare to do so fearing immediate arrest,'' the police said.
''Three persons were involved in the crime. We arrested Santosh Kumar Basnet (34) and Megh Bahadur Khatri (32) both from Dang and Chandra Bhupal Pun from Rukum is absconding,'' the Himalayan Times quoted Joint-Commissioner at the Metropolitan Police Crime Division (MPCD) SSP Upendra Kanta Aryal as saying.
